Two shocking incidents of crime against women rocked Allahabad district on Saturday.

In the first incident, two motorcycle-borne youths threw acid on a class 11 student in Koraon area while in the other, an 18-year-old girl, who was going to a madarsa, was stabbed by a youth in Naini area for repelling his advances.
In the Koraon incident , the girl, a resident of Badauwa Kala village, was going to school when the youths, who had their faces covered with a cloth, came from behind and threw acid on her. The girl, however, managed to duck and escape with burns on only one of her arms. She raised an alarm but the attackers sped away. The girl was later admitted to a nearby CHC for treatment.
“Two youths were detained on suspicion, but released after the victim failed to recognise them,” Inspector Koraon Krishnapal Singh said. “Further action in the incident will be taken after receiving complaint from the victim,” he added.
In the Naini incident, the girl, of Mahewa area under Naini police station, was going to a nearby madarsa when the youth stabbed her with a knife several times before local residents could rush to save her.
The youth, identified as Janib, was later caught and was handed over to the police. He was stalking the girl since long and was enraged when she repelled his advances. The injured girl was admitted to a hospital where her condition was reported to be critical.
